Visitors to the Hollis Court building may not enter the spare-hardware storage room on the ground floor under any circumstances. Only badged Torvane Systems staff may retrieve equipment, and all items must be logged in the ledger by the door. If a visitor requires a loaner laptop or adapter, the facilities desk retrieves it on their behalf and records the visitor's host. For staff retrieving items after hours, the keypad accepts the following code.

door code, yagap-bahof: bdg-O-05

## Tax-Rate Lookup Cache — Approval Process

The Quillbrook tax-rate lookup cache refreshes jurisdiction rates every six hours from the Rateledger service. Support staff cannot flush the cache directly; any manual invalidation requires an approved request, since a bad flush can cause checkout delays across all Marrow Lane storefronts. File the request in the Quillbrook ops queue with the affected region codes and a reason. Approvals are typically granted within one business day. The approver of record is named below.

named custodian: Brivan Eliath Quenox Frador

SockPress is the websocket gateway for the Varnholt dashboard. Per-message deflate saves bandwidth but costs roughly 30% more CPU per connection, so it's off by default. Enable it with WS_COMPRESS=1 only on the high-latency regional nodes; keep WS_COMPRESS_LEVEL at 3 or below, since higher levels showed no measurable payload reduction in our tests. Context takeover is disabled permanently to bound memory. Compressed frames still need signing before relay to the Varnholt edge, and the signing key goes on the next line of the env file.

vault entry, yahif-yajep: COURIER_KEY29=b802bdf8034096b65a51c6ba5abe2

Runbook: Invoiceleaf PDF renderer, restart procedure. If rendered invoices show blank line items, the font cache on the render node is corrupt. Drain the node from the Papertrail queue, clear `/var/cache/ivl-fonts`, and restart the renderer service. Verify with a test invoice before re-enabling traffic. Restart calls to the render control API require authentication; the internal key is provided below.

app token of yajeg-kawef = kto11_7En3XSX8xQw